Transaction 34ba391a494905ae0da87242a7127a067bfc276821d105852e17d421d0c672f3
1 Input
1 Output
-
34ba391a494905ae0da87242a7127a067bfc276821d105852e17d421d0c672f3:0
- value
- 931332
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e37860d71cc815532381fbfcbabfa9c520803fb OP_EQUALVERIFY OP_CHECKSIG
- address
- 13kmnc71t2Rhzx8wrjPtxJrfnSLAU15q2M